n8n是什么?n8n 是一款开源、灵活且高度可定制的工作流自动化平台,其核心理念是通过可视化拖拽界面将不同的应用、服务、API或数据源连接起来,实现复杂的自动化任务,而无需编写大量代码。n8n 的名字源于德语 “nur ein Ninja”(意为“只是一个忍者”),寓意其强大、灵活又轻盈。下面,AI部落带您了解这款开源工具如何简化复杂任务。
01 开源利器:重新定义工作流自动化
n8n 是一款基于节点的开源可视化工作流自动化工具,它通过直观的拖放界面,让用户像搭积木一样连接各种应用和服务。
与需要编写复杂脚本的传统方式不同,n8n 让非技术人员也能快速构建复杂的自动化流程。
截至2025年7月的数据显示,n8n 在 GitHub 上已经获得超过54,000颗星标,显示出开源社区对它的高度认可。n8n 支持超过400种服务的集成,涵盖了常用的微信、钉钉、各类数据库等。
更重要的是,n8n 采用“公平代码”许可模式,用户可以免费进行私有化部署,完全掌控自己的数据和安全。
02 核心优势:可视化与丰富的集成生态
n8n 的核心优势在于其直观的可视化界面和强大的集成能力。在工作流画布上,每个节点代表一个操作步骤,节点之间的连线表示数据流向。
这种可视化表示方式对处理复杂的分支逻辑特别有效。n8n 内置了超过400个预制节点,覆盖了从Google Workspace、MySQL、HubSpot到Slack等主流应用。
如果遇到没有预制节点的情况,用户可以使用HTTP请求节点连接任何提供API的服务。n8n 还提供了代码节点,支持JavaScript和Python,让开发人员可以在需要时编写自定义逻辑。
03 模板宝库:4300+即用型工作流
对于刚接触n8n的用户来说,最大的障碍往往不是工具本身,而是不知道从何开始。为此,开源社区创建了 “n8n-workflows”项目,它收录了4343个生产级工作流模板,覆盖365个主流API接口。
这些模板涵盖了各种应用场景,从简单的数据同步到复杂的AI内容生成,用户可以直接导入使用,大大节省了开发时间。
这个模板库的技术实现也令人印象深刻:它采用三层架构设计,使用FastAPI异步框架支持高并发请求,并通过SQLite FTS5全文检索引擎实现毫秒级模板搜索。
相比最初的v1版本,项目体积从35GB压缩至50MB,压缩比达到惊人的700倍。
04 实战场景:从概念到落地的应用
n8n的实际应用场景非常广泛。在量化交易领域,它可以用于数据采集层的工作,如通过Webhook实时接收交易所行情推送,定时抓取上市公司财报和舆情数据。
在内容创作领域,n8n可以实现AI内容生成并自动发布——从输入文本到调用大模型生成内容和配图,再到自动上传并发布到微信公众号草稿箱,全程自动化。
对于日常办公,n8n可以一键打通微信、钉钉与数据库,当数据库中有新记录时,自动发送消息到微信和钉钉。n8n还可以实现多平台信息聚合,自动获取各领域最新资讯,整理后分发到不同平台。
05 部署与云服务:简化上云路径
n8n提供了灵活的部署选项,用户可以通过Docker或Kubernetes自行托管,也可以使用n8n的云平台。对于需要更高可控性和安全性的企业,私有化部署是理想选择。
部署n8n的过程本身也可以很简单。例如,利用免费的Hugging Face账户(提供免费2核16G服务器)和Supabase账户(提供免费500MB数据库),就能零成本搭建一个私有的n8n自动化平台。
当然,对于生产环境下的企业级应用,一个稳定可靠的云服务平台至关重要。这正是像PetaCloud这样的全球云服务提供商的价值所在。
PetaCloud提供稳定、高性价比的全球云服务能力,能够简化上云流程,消除技术复杂性。无论是需要全球部署的业务,还是对数据安全有严格要求的场景,PetaCloud都能提供合适的解决方案,帮助用户快速部署和管理n8n这样的自动化工具,让企业可以专注于业务逻辑本身,而非基础设施的维护。
在量化交易团队的实际应用中,传统自研一个数据采集系统需要2周开发时间加上持续的维护成本,而使用n8n方案,只需要30分钟配置,且几乎是零维护成本。
当系统监控警报触发时,n8n工作流不会向每个人发送垃圾邮件,而是智能地根据服务所有权和警报严重程度,将信息传递给正确的团队成员。
AI部落温馨提示:以上是对n8n是什么?了解这款开源工具如何简化复杂任务的介绍,点击PetaCloud官网,了解PetaCloud虚拟机,释放云计算无线可能!
本文由网上采集发布,不代表我们立场,转载联系作者并注明出处:https://www.aijto.com/11638.html

